The institute’s placement outcomes vary across programs, with MBA/PGDM students typically securing higher packages compared to their MCA counterparts. Here’s a snapshot of recent placement statistics:
VIIT-Placement Overview
Branch/Course | Avg Package (LPA) | Highest Package (LPA) | % Placed / No. Placed | College Avg Placement (LPA) | Additional Info | Student Review on Placement Data |
MBA/PGDM | 4–6 | 8–10 | 70–80% | 2.83 | Specializations: IT & Systems, Finance, Marketing | Good IT sector placements with major recruiters visiting campus |
MCA | 3–5 | 7–8 | 60–75% | 2.83 | Strong focus on software development roles | Average placements but helpful training sessions for interviews |
Key Observations
- MBA/PGDM Dominance: MBA specializations in IT & Systems, Finance, and Marketing drive stronger placement outcomes, with 70–80% of students securing roles in IT services, banking, and retail sectors. The highest packages often come from IT firms seeking candidates with dual expertise in management and technology.
- MCA Trends: While MCA placements are moderately successful, the institute’s emphasis on software development and interview preparation helps students secure roles in mid-tier IT companies and startups.
VIIT-Recruitment Process and Support Systems
VIIT follows a structured recruitment cycle, beginning with pre-placement talks, aptitude tests, and technical interviews. The training cell organizes workshops on coding, case studies, and communication skills, ensuring students are industry-ready. Key initiatives include:
- Industry-Aligned Curriculum: Courses integrate certifications in cloud computing, data analytics, and digital marketing, making students competitive in niche domains.
- Internship Opportunities: Mandatory summer internships with local IT firms and SMEs provide hands-on experience, often leading to pre-placement offers.
- Alumni Network: Over 10,000 alumni in leadership roles at companies like TCS, Infosys, and Capgemini facilitate referrals and mentorship.
VIIT-Sector-Wide Opportunities
The institute’s placement trends mirror broader industry demands:
- IT & Tech Roles: With Maharashtra’s Pune-Nashik industrial corridor emerging as a tech hub, VIIT’s MCA graduates find opportunities in software development, QA testing, and system administration.
- Management Roles: MBA graduates are recruited for supply chain management, financial analysis, and digital marketing roles, reflecting the diversification of India’s service sector.
VIIT-Infrastructure and Industry Ties
VIIT’s 30-acre campus supports placement activities with:
- A 120-seat auditorium for recruitment drives.
- Five computer labs equipped with advanced software tools.
- Collaborations with regional chambers of commerce to connect students with SMEs and startups.
